Output 29631f487fc563a96f4f2bbffd0c90568cdcf2a719d221508df5decf8e5d94ca:12

value
5342176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 691006d5bc78910e357c2be912a89de991d78d8b OP_EQUAL
address
3BGY5EuKKdVReHew3RAyiuZghtrCB8xi4e
transaction
29631f487fc563a96f4f2bbffd0c90568cdcf2a719d221508df5decf8e5d94ca
spent
true